Corn: weather has always been a factor to reckon with

SOFIA. Two stories to tell so far. On a national level, overall sporadic rains favor the development of the crop because the soil receives the necessary moisture content. And second, on a local level, because of the hailstorms in the beginning of the month, some farmers got total loss. Anyhow, in the beginning of next month, more precipitation is forecasted. Heavy storms are not totally discounted though!

If the odds, on a national level, continue to be in favor of farmers, this year’s aggregate output could be higher by as much as 20%, as local farmers expect. Anyhow, the start of the harvesting season is still in the distance.

Market developments

Domestic trade is predominant on a weekly basis, as exports are sluggish at best. Short-term forecast is for the trend to continue as drastic changes in market sentiment is not expected. Prices fluctuate depending on local demand, as the general trend in the past few weeks seems to have been a subsequent recovery in the value of prices after experiencing a downward fall.

Harvest 2016-17

(01.09.2016 - 14.07.2017)

Carry over

400,000 mt

Domestic output

2,226,094 mt

Domestic consumption

1,047,000 mt

Exports to the world

921,207 mt

Source: Bulgarian Ministry of Agriculture

By the middle of the month, remaining quantities stood at 755,255 mt.
